Abstract

The utility model is related to hang attachment lowering or hoisting gear technical field, refers specifically to a kind of ring body formula mosquito net lifter;Including frame, the frame has top board and base plate, is equipped with central shaft between top board and base plate vertically, and frame is provided with the clutch lowering or hoisting gear for driving central shaft to move up and down;The central shaft be provided with female wheel component, drive gear and linkage disk, the side of frame is provided with ring body support, the lower end of ring body support is fixedly connected with base plate, is provided with ring body support between the sub- wheel assembly that can be horizontally rotated, and sub- wheel assembly and linkage disk and is connected with transmission belt;Bus wheel of the present utility model and sub-line wheel are in close elevation plane and near ceiling plane, the friction interference probability between pull rope and female wheel component, sub- wheel assembly can effectively be reduced, make overall operation more smooth, the integrally-built flattening of lifter is conducive to design, disassembly, cleaning convenience and safety in utilization are improved, stabilization simple for structure, is had wide range of applications.

Background technology
Mosquito net is that we spend the common articles for use of hot summer, and it can effectively prevent biting for mosquito.Relative to killing Worm agent and mosquito-repellent incense, the use of mosquito net have the advantages that environmental protection, health and safety, low-carbon (LC) low cost.Exist on the market various The mosquito net of type, such as traditional mosquito net, it uses Corner Strapped point hang, and for example the mosquito net of mobile edition, and it passes through can Folding frame is supported, and both mosquito nets have respective advantage and disadvantage, simple structure but operation inconvenience in use.To have Effect improves the Discussing Convenience of Usage of bednets, the elevating mechanism operation of various mosquito nets and gives birth to, and is very easy to mosquito net in daily Use, such as the Chinese invention patent of publication number CN104444885A, it discloses a kind of balance lifting device, including support, Gu Due to the fixing axle on support, the fixing axle top is provided with drive mechanism, and fixing axle bottom is provided with line wheel component, the driving Clutch is provided between mechanism and line wheel component, the line wheel component includes some twisted rope disks, the twisted rope disk and clutch Overload separation mechanism is provided between structure, it can effectively realize the functions such as mosquito net balance lifting, parked, automatic adjustable balance.But Prior art still cannot solve the problems, such as mosquito net integral elevating, so that the repetition of inconvenient mosquito net, veiling in daily cleaning Problem is removed and installed, and the drive mechanism of lifter is arranged vertically, twisted rope disk moves towards there is drop with installation furred ceiling with cable, makes Easily there is the friction kinking problem of cable during.Therefore, prior art has yet to be improved and developed.
